Hola a todos, acabo de probar el codigo, solo un detalle:
if ricura.eof and
ricura.bof then
cambiar por :
if rs_ricura.eof and
rs_ricura.bof then
cuando hago la consulta mediante:
.../index.asp?shk=1 (puede ser 1,2,3,4,5,6. los q estan en la BD)
no hay problema devuelve los registros.
Para shk=1500 (q no esta en la BD) devuelve el mensaje de
"no hay registros".
Hasta aqui todo bien, pero fui un poco mas alla, probe con ../index.asp?shk =1a
(q obviamente no esta en la BD pero es un dato alfanumerico) , y cuan sopresa
hace explicito el campo de consulta (id_ricura), como sigue:
=====
Microsoft JET Database Engine error '80040e14'
Error de sintaxis (falta operador) en la expresión de consulta 'id_ricura = 1a'.
/formi/ricuras/index.asp, line 21
=====
En este caso deveria devolver que
"no hay registros" pero como ven no es asi.
Alguien sabe cual es problema?